The Cadillac Lyriq: A New Era
The Cadillac Lyriq represents a significant milestone for the brand. Launched as a 2023 model, it showcases Cadillac’s commitment to electrification while maintaining the luxury and performance the brand is known for. Here are some key features of the Lyriq:
- Design: The Lyriq features a sleek, modern design with a distinctive front grille and signature lighting.
- Performance: With an estimated range of over 300 miles, the Lyriq is built for both efficiency and performance.
- Technology: The vehicle is equipped with advanced technology, including a large infotainment screen and driver-assistance features.
- Interior: The interior boasts premium materials and spacious seating, ensuring a luxurious driving experience.

The Lyriq’s Technology Features
One of the standout aspects of the Cadillac Lyriq is its technology. The vehicle is designed to enhance the driving experience through various innovative features:
- Super Cruise: Cadillac’s hands-free driving technology allows for a more relaxed driving experience on compatible highways.
- Infotainment System: The Lyriq features a state-of-the-art infotainment system with voice recognition and smartphone integration.
- Battery Management: Advanced battery management systems ensure optimal performance and longevity of the vehicle’s battery.
- Connectivity: Over-the-air updates keep the vehicle’s software current, enhancing functionality and performance over time.
